Course Content

• Historical Context of the Armenian Genocide
• Ottoman Empire & Young Turk Regime: Causes and Precursors
• Armenian Genocide: Documentation and Methodology
• Analysis of Primary Sources: Testimonies, Photographs, and Documents
• The Armenian Diaspora & Memory
• Legal Aspects and International Recognition of the Armenian Genocide
• Comparative Genocide Studies
• Digital Humanities and Armenian Genocide Studies
